Henrik Ripa facts for kids
Henrik Ripa (born May 14, 1968 – died July 12, 2020) was a Swedish politician. He was a member of the Swedish Parliament from 2010 to 2014. He belonged to a political party called Moderaterna.

Early Life and Political Start
Henrik Ripa was born in 1968. He started his political career in the town of Lerum. From 1998 to 2010, he was the chairman of the Lerum municipality. This means he was a main leader for the local government in that area.
Serving in Parliament
After his work in Lerum, Henrik Ripa became a member of the Swedish Parliament. He represented an area called Västra Götaland North. This area is in the western part of Sweden. As a Member of Parliament, he helped make laws for the whole country.
Helping with Health
In the Swedish Parliament, Henrik Ripa was part of a special group. This group was called the Committee on Health and Welfare. He helped make decisions about public health for everyone. He also worked on rules for social services and dental care.
